Write an equation in standard form for the line whose slope is undefined and and passes through (-6,4).

Answers

A line whose slope is undefined has no finite slope; the line is a vertical one.
A vertical line has an equation of the form x = k.  In this case, since the line passes thru (-6,4), the eq'n of the line is x = -6.

The equation represents a vertical line passing through the point (-6, 4) is x= -6.

When the slope is undefined, it means that the line is vertical.

In this case, the line passes through the point (-6, 4).

A vertical line has the equation of the form x = k, where k is a constant. Since the line passes through (-6, 4), the equation of the line in standard form is:

x = -6

This equation represents a vertical line passing through the point (-6, 4).

Can you help me list the following stocks and bonds in order from highest default risk to lowest default risk?
-A municipal bond in a city with a population of 150,000
-A common stock in a company under federal investigation
-A preferred stock in a 150-year old firm with good business practices

Answers

Final answer:

From highest to lowest default risk, the investments would likely be ranked as follows: common stock in a company under federal investigation, a municipal bond from a relatively small city, and preferred stock in a stable, long-established firm.

Explanation:

The default risk of a financial investment is the likelihood that the issuer of the instrument will be unable to meet their obligations, thereby causing a default. From the highest to lowest default risk, the list would likely be:

Common stock in a company currently under federal investigation: This company has the highest default risk because the investigation could lead to penalties, disruptions in its business, or damage to its reputation.A municipal bond from a city with a population of 150,000: Though generally considered safe, these bonds can still go into default. The default risk here is lower than the stock under investigation because municipal bonds are backed by the taxes and revenue of the municipality, making them more stable than corporations which are dependent on their business performance.A preferred stock in a 150-year old firm with good business practices: This has the lowest default risk. Preferred stocks have a lower risk than common stocks because they receive dividends before common stock and have a higher claim on the assets in case of bankruptcy. The age of the firm and its good business practices also suggest stability and reduced risk.

How do you divide fractions

Answers

Use the Keep, Change, Flip method.

Keep the first fraction.
Change the division sign to a multiplication sign.
Flip the last fraction (reciprocal).

Example:
3/4 ÷ 1/2

Keep the 3/4.
Change the ÷ sign to ×.
Flip the 1/2 to 2/1.

New equation:
3/4 × 2/1 = 6/4 ⇒ 3/2

The answer for 3/4 ÷ 1/2 is 3/2.

The height of a ball in feet is modeled by
[tex]y = - 16x {}^{2} + 72x[/tex]
where X is the time in seconds after the ball is hit. How long is the ball in the air?

(May I also get steps on how to solve these kind of questions please?)

Answers

The answer to this question is 4.5 seconds. You can see from the graph that the ball is above the ground in the interval 0 < t < 4.5. It is at t = 4.5 where the graph touches the t-axis. When it touches the t-axis, then the height is 0 and therefore on the ground.

The value of time of the ball in the air is,

⇒ 4.5 seconds

What is Quadratic equation?

An algebraic equation with the second degree of the variable is called an Quadratic equation.

We have to given that;

The height of a ball in feet is modeled by the equation,

y = - 16x² + 72x

where, x is the time in seconds after the ball is hit.

Hence, For time of the ball in the air, we can plug y = 0 in above equation.

y = - 16x² + 72x

0 = - 16x² + 72x

Solve for x;

- 16x² + 72x = 0

- 4x (4x - 18) = 0

This gives,

4x = 18

x = 18/4

x = 4.5 seconds

Thus, The value of time of the ball in the air is,

⇒ 4.5 seconds
